ADJUSTMENT OF RUNNING ENGINE THRESHOLD
Normally no adjustment needs to be carried out, but if it is necessary to carry it out: stop the engine.
Choose the voltage threshold coming from the charging alternator (terminal D+).
Adjustment range 3 to 12 (12V) 6 to 24 (24V). Factory setting 7V (14V).
